Benjamin Risse, With an exceptional h-index of 16 and a recent h-index of 14 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Westfälische Wilhelms-Universität Münster, specializes in the field of Computer Vision, Machine Learning, Ecology, Additive Manufacturing, Biomedical Image Processing.
